Product Description
At last, a compendium of sound, practical, tried-and-tested advice for teachers. Teaching in schools - at primary or secondary level - can be hugely rewarding, but is undeniably ever more demanding. To reap the real rewards of their work while keeping up with changes in the curriculum, teachers are faced with a whole range of practical issues. These range from honing their skills relating to curriculum planning, supporting learning and effective assessment, through to getting to grips with the latest technology and working with difficult pupils or classes. At a time when most teachers seem to have to cope with unprecedented amounts of red tape, this compendium aims to support them in what they really want to do: help pupils to learn successfully. Compiled from experience, observation and research, 2000 Tips for Teachers is essential reading for all teachers, providing access to wide-ranging and practical advice and ideas, presented here in a unique, easy-to-use format. This book will save you time and help you to further your personal and professional development, and brings together guidance on subjects including: effective teaching processes; designing and implementing assessment; supporting pupils' learning; using ICT, both within and without the curriculum; supporting pupils with special needs; pastoral care; using resources effectively; dealing with difficult and unacceptable behaviour; developing your own career and professional life. Written for the busy teacher whose time for reading the literature on teaching and learning is limited, these accessible, practical suggestions will be useful for trainee, newly qualified and experienced teachers alike, in primary and secondary schools as well as in further education.
